Morocco's social commerce sector has experienced rapid growth, with influencer sales reaching approximately 3.2 billion MAD in 2026. The increasing number of active influencers, now around 15,000, indicates a vibrant digital influencer ecosystem that significantly impacts consumer purchasing decisions. The average monthly sales per influencer is about 213,000 MAD, reflecting effective monetization strategies and growing consumer trust in social platforms.
Market penetration has climbed to 28%, showing that social commerce is becoming a mainstream shopping avenue in Morocco. Engagement metrics remain high, with an average of 6.4% in post interaction rates, suggesting strong audience involvement. These trends emphasize the importance of influencer marketing in Morocco’s evolving digital economy, shaping future retail strategies and consumer habits.
